: Tire Pressure Monitoring System If the warning light comes on, this indicates one or more of the tires has low air pressure. Check the pressure of each tire, includ­ing the spare, and ll with air as soon as possible. If the warning light still stays on, the system should be checked by an authorized Mitsubishi Motors dealer.
C
: Supplemental Restraint System Immediately have the vehicle checked by an authorized Mitsubishi Motors dealer if the light comes on and stays on while driv­ing, because this indicates a problem with the system.
D
: Passenger Air Bag Off Indicator The indicator light will stay on while driving to show that the passenger front air bag is not operational when:
• The passenger seat weight sensors sense a weight of less than
about 66 pounds on the front passenger seat.
• The front passenger seat is not occupied.
The indicator light will go off while driving to show that the passenger front air bag is operational when the weight applied to the front passenger seat is sensed at about 66 pounds or greater. This includes a large dog sitting in the front passen­ger seat or heavy packages.

EXTERIOR LIGHT CONTROL
To TuRn on/oFF The
comBinaTion
headlighT
Rotate the switch at the end of the turn signal lever. OFF: All the lights will turn off. : The parking, tail, front/rear side-marker, license plate and instrument panel lights will turn on respectively. : Headlights and other lights will turn on respectively. If the light switch is at the or , the ignition key is turned to “LOCK” or “ACC” position or removed from the ignition switch, and the driver’s door is opened, the lights will automatically turn off. If the light switch is at the or position, the ignition key is turned to “LOCK” or “ACC” or removed from the ignition switch, and the driver’s door is closed, the lights will stay on for about three minutes and turn off automatically.
To change The headlighTs FRom
high Beam To loW Beam
Pull the turn signal lever fully toward you to change the headlight beam height. The high beam indicator comes on when the headlights are on high beam, and goes off when the headlights are on low beam.

TheFT alaRm sysTem
(If equipped) Arm the system by locking the doors with the transmitter or power door locks. The horn will sound intermittently and the headlights will blink on and off for three minutes. The system will then be rearmed until the system is disarmed. To disarm the system: (1) All doors or the tailgate are unlocked by the remote control transmitter or by using the key. (2) The ignition key is turned to the “ACC” or “ON” position. (3) If the UNLOCK button is pressed when all doors and the tailgate are closed and no door is opened within approximately 30 seconds, rearming will automatically occur.
elecTRonic immoBilizeR
(Anti-theft starting system) You can start the vehicle with only the keys that have been registered to the vehicle. If you lose the key, you can order a key from your authorized Mitsubishi Motors dealer by referring to the key number. Take your vehicle and all remaining keys to your authorized Mitsubishi Motors dealer to have your ID code changed to prevent vehicle theft.
